Knowing the Roles and Types of Estimators in Construction Projects.
A construction estimator in the construction industry has a duty of reviewing plans, estimating costs in materials, labor, and equipment and giving advice on budgets to the stakeholders.
Key roles include:
- Cost Analyst – specializes in cost tracking and variance analysis.
- Chief Estimator – leads teams for large, complex projects.
- Estimator Firm / Construction Estimating Services – outsourced partners offering full estimating solutions.
In-house vs Outsourced Construction Estimators
Many large companies keep an in-house building estimator, while smaller contractors or one-time developers often rely on construction cost estimating services for their flexibility and scalability.

Specializations
- Commercial Construction Estimator – handles complex bids for offices, malls, and infrastructure.
- Home Construction Estimator or House Construction Cost Estimator – focuses on residential projects.
- Specialists in MEP, electrical, civil, concrete estimating — ideal for niche project needs.
When to hire vs outsource:
- Hire in-house if you have frequent ongoing projects.
- Outsource to top construction estimating services or best construction estimating companies if you need flexibility or access to broader expertise.

How do you estimate construction costs?
Follow a structured process—define scope, measure quantities, apply current unit rates, add indirects, risk, and markup—then sanity-check against past projects.
A Quick Step-by-step process:
- Define scope & assumptions – drawings/specs, site constraints, schedule, quality level, procurement plan.
- Quantity takeoff – measure materials, labor hours, and equipment needs from plans/BIM.
- Price direct costs
- Materials: supplier quotes + wastage.
- Labor: crew productivity × hours × local wage rates.
- Equipment/plant: own vs rental, mobilization, fuel.
- Subcontractors: get at least 2–3 comparable quotes.
- Add indirects/soft costs – permits, insurance, bonds, temp works, supervision, site facilities, testing, utilities.
- Risk & contingency – typically 5–15% (higher for early design or complex sites).
- Escalation & currency – index for expected price inflation over the project timeline.
- Overhead & profit – company OH (e.g., 8–12%) + target margin.
- Taxes/duties – VAT/sales tax, import duties if applicable.
- Cross-checks – bottom-up vs parametric ($/sf, $/m², $/LF) vs analogous (similar past jobs).
- Sensitivity review – test best/likely/worst cases for volatile items (steel, concrete, MEP).
- Document & version – date, basis of estimate, inclusions/exclusions, clarifications.
Simple formula:
Total Cost = (Materials + Labor + Equipment + Subcontracts) + Indirects + Contingency + Escalation + Overhead + Profit + Taxes

Accuracy guide (typical):
- Conceptual: ±30–50%
- Design-development: ±15–25%
- Detailed/tender: ±5–10%

Tools that help: digital takeoff + cost databases, scheduling links (for labor/equipment time), and a disciplined change-log.
Common mistakes to avoid: vague scope, missing quantities, outdated rates, zero/low contingency, ignoring logistics/phasing, and poor version control.
Deliverables to include: priced BoQ/takeoff, assumptions, contingency rationale, vendor quotes, and a one-page executive summary with range and key risks.

How Modern Tools & Methods Improve Estimation Accuracy
Modern construction estimator workflows rely on digital tools:
- Best Construction Estimating Software: PlanSwift, ProEst, STACK, Sage Estimating, etc.
- Methodologies: bottom-up, parametric, analogous, hybrid approaches.
- Cost Databases: RSMeans, regional supplier data, market indices.
- Integrations: BIM for accurate takeoffs, scheduling software for progress tracking.
- Emerging Tech: AI and machine learning for predictive costing; drones for data collection.
Investing in advanced tools boosts productivity and reduces human error.
Common Challenges and Pitfalls and How to Avoid Them
Even the experienced construction estimators have difficulties. Common pitfalls include:
- Underestimating contingencies or ignoring risk factors.
- Not being able to make regional or seasonal price adjustments.
- This is due to poor communication that has resulted in miscommunication on drawings.
- Bigger scope increases without increased budget.
- No version control/documentation.
These problems are prevented by regular audits and workflows between estimator, designer and contractor.

FAQs
Q: What is the difference between an estimator in the construction industry and quantity surveyor?
A: Estimators are concerned with the initial cost prediction, quantity surveyors are usually maintained in the whole project so as to control and regulate the costs.
Q: Will I hire an estimator on a full time basis or opt to outsource to construction estimating services?
A: Full-time personnel is appropriate in companies where there is high frequency of projects; outsourcing is appropriate in one-time or seasonal cases.
Q: How often should estimates be updated?
A: At key design milestones and whenever material or labor markets shift.
Q: What’s the acceptable error margin in estimates?
A: The estimator in construction is Typically ±5-10% for detailed estimates, wider for early conceptual ones.
Q: How to handle change orders and re-estimates?
A: Have clear processes, communicate promptly, and use updated data from your building estimator or service provider.
